Martha Bolton's observations about life and growing older nail what everyone feels but can’t express. "Who Put All This Sand in My Hourglass Figure," "When I Am Old I Shall Be Purple," and "Allow Me to Repeat Myself…Again" are just a few of the topics her fans--both new and old--will be laughing at as they nod in agreement. This book is funny and will bring a chuckle to your lips. It covers things such as Three sit-up count a sexercise, People hold door open for you, which usually gets you in line in front of them, You can talk to yourself with or without a headset.This book was written by the same author of DIDN"T MY SKIN USED TO FIT? She has written over fifty books and her pages will enlighten you, give you ideas and most of all make you smile and realize getting older isn't so bad after all.
